Safety While bunk beds are an excellent way to save space and make kids' rooms more enjoyable, they can also pose serious safety risks. They can result in injuries and falls due to the fact that they can lift children off the floor while they sleep. To avoid this from happening, parents should take steps to ensure the safety of their child. Installing the guardrails in a safe manner is among the most important things to do. They must be at least 5 inches above the mattress and should not have gaps that children can fall through. The ladder should be properly fixed and positioned so that kids cannot climb over it. Additionally, the foundation should be sturdy enough to be able to support both mattresses equally. Other measures to protect yourself include removing tripping hazards from the ladder and top bunk access point, which includes ropes, clothing and toys. Encourage your children to take away these items prior to going bed and remind them to do so often. A nightlight that is placed close to the ladder will illuminate the pathway leading from and to the bed, reducing the risk of children falling or tripping in the darkness. It is also crucial for children to be taught how to use the ladder or stairs correctly. It is crucial to instruct children to ascend the stairs slowly and cautiously. Ladders must be securely fixed to the frame of the bunk bed, and placed in a way that they don't sit too close to a dresser or wall. Also, children should not sit or lean on the edge of the upper bunk because this could cause the structure or the bed to collapse. Parents should also inspect the bunk beds for signs of wear and tear or damage. It is best to buy bunk beds from reliable stores that have good return policies.
